§1496. Use of funds Funds made available to the commissioner shall be expended to effectuate the purposes of this Part including but not limited to the following uses:
(1)To attract additional business associated with the industrial hemp industry to
Louisiana including processors.
(2)To develop and promote Louisiana industrial hemp brands or marketing
campaigns.
(3)To aid in the development of a coordinated research plan designed to develop
higher quality industrial hemp seeds and plants best suited for cultivation within the state,
new and improved uses for industrial hemp, and best management practices.
(4)To develop educational programs and disseminate educational materials about
industrial hemp.
(5)To support the enhancement and maintenance of public-use industrial hemp
facilities
